Rating:  Summary: It really is the perfect bedtime book! Review: This book is just great for bedtime. The illustrations are soft and colorful and the text is easy-to-read, rhyming and repetitive. Each two-page spread shows an animal playing in the daytime. Then, when you fold-out the pages, you reveal the animal sleeping at night, with a large and soft textured area for children to touch and pet. The textured areas are soft, comforting and encourage sleepiness. As your little one pets each animal, the text on the page says things like "lay down your sleepy head...now it's time for bed" and so on. The last page shows a child playing in the park and when you open up the folded pages, the child can be tucked into bed under a soft felt blanket--the perfect exercise for bedtime. It's not just the illustrations that make this book wonderful--it's the value. It's only $9.95, but the book itself is very large and bulky (the spine is over an inch thick!) and so this is a great book to package up with a receiving blanket, baby pajamas or crib mobile for a baby shower. It is inexpensive, but beautifully done and feels very substantial. I have given copies to several friends with infants and toddlers.
